Gulf: improving budget positions to allow austerity to ease

Budget positions across the Gulf should improve over the next couple of years – and many will return to surplus – supported in large part by higher oil prices. As a result, governments across the region are likely to ease up on fiscal austerity, while the pace of debt issuance is set to slow.
